A Smart luggage features like GPS tracking, USB charging ports, and built-in scales can be useful for tech-savvy travelers. However, ensure the battery is removable, as some airlines have restrictions on non-removable lithium batteries.

A Most airlines allow one carry-on bag and one personal item (e.g., a purse, laptop bag, or small backpack). The personal item must fit under the seat in front of you.

A To reduce the risk of lost luggage:
- Use a unique luggage tag with your contact information.
- Add identification inside your bag.
- Take a photo of your luggage for reference.
- Consider using a luggage tracker (e.g., Apple AirTag or Tile).

A Items prohibited in carry-on luggage include:
-Liquids over 3.4 ounces (100 ml) (unless in a quart-sized, clear plastic bag).
- Sharp objects (e.g., knives, scissors with blades longer than 4 inches).
- Tools (e.g., hammers, screwdrivers).
- Sports equipment (e.g., baseball bats, golf clubs).

A Certain items are prohibited in checked luggage, including:
- Lithium batteries (e.g., power banks, spare laptop batteries).
- Flammable items (e.g., lighter fluid, fireworks).
- Valuables (e.g., cash, jewelry, electronics).
- Perishable items (e.g., food that can spoil quickly).

A Most airlines allow carry-on luggage with dimensions of around **22 x 14 x 9 inches (56 x 36 x 23 cm)**, including handles and wheels. However, size restrictions can vary by airline, so always check your airline’s guidelines before traveling.
